Not really.  I didn't see the singularity of the "big crown thingy" as that much significant on Twilight's part (for one thing, it represents the Element of Magic, which is the most important element in itself and therefore was not necessarily tailored toward Twilight).  And of course, powerful magic is just powerful magic.

 

Also, I think it is helpful if we distinguish between becoming a princess and becoming an alicorn.  It is not immediately apparent that all alicorns are royalty (although it is empirically so), and if Prince Blueblood is any indication, the converse is plainly false (unless only females can be royalty in the fullest sense).  (It is also useful to note that Cadence was originally supposed to be only a unicorn until Hasbro decided that her character needed to sell more toys.)  So maybe the "big crown thingy" might have been a foreshadowing of Twilight becoming a princess, but not necessarily an alicorn.  I sometimes think that the backlash against the change might have been blunted a bit if she became only one of the two, but not both.

Not really but in retrospect I am surprised that I didn't.

For starters Twilight's special talent is magic and was the strongest magical unicorn since Star Swirl the Bearded which already puts her on a whole other level 

Then the show had built her up as the personal student of Princess Celestia the ruler of Equestria for over a thousand years which also puts her on a level most ponies wouldn't be on.

There is also Winter Wrap Up where Twilight ended up getting the job to organize the tasks of Ponyville to clear up winter putting ehr in a position of power that foreshadowed her becoming a princess.

Then there is the fact that Twilight was the element of magic which was the strongest element of harmony and was a tiara which also helped foreshadow her inevitable coronation.

There also is the Cutie Mark Chronicles episode where she went into the avatar state and hatched Spike and made him grow huge in a sheer displace of powerful magic that ended up getting her accepted into Celestia's prestigious magical academy.  Personally after seeing what Twilight was capable of even as a filly I like to believe that because of that Celestia saw the potential of Twilight to become a princess and eventually groomed her to become one.

Then there was the Crystal Empire where Celestia and Luna discussed the next level of Twilight's studies and how like Celestia and Luna had their cutie marks behind them during the speech Twilight also had her cutie mark behind her as well as the subtle foreshadowing of Star Swirl's unfinished spell during the episode.
